WebMar 15, 2024 · There are three possibilities: PRs can administer an insolvent estate out of court. The PRs gather in the estate assets and administer them as required by relevant legislation, which we discuss below. This is the most common method of administration of insolvent estates. PRs can administer an insolvent estate under the court’s direction. WebGenerally speaking, insolvency refers to situations where a debtor cannot pay the debts they owe. For instance, a troubled company may become insolvent when it is unable to repay its creditors money owed on time, often leading to a bankruptcy filing. WebIn accounting, insolvency is the state of being unable to pay the debts, by a person or company ( debtor ), at maturity; those in a state of insolvency are said to be insolvent. There are two forms: cash-flow insolvency and balance-sheet insolvency. Cash-flow insolvency is when a person or company has enough assets to pay what is owed, but does ...
